Overlapping sequential data sets

The operation overlaps two event data sets <data1> and <data2> based on the orders that are defined through the corresponding key data sets <key1> and <key2>. The principle is presented in the figure below. The operation assumes that the data sets have been ordered according to the key frame in the ascending order. Then, it compares the "time" frames and collects mized codes to the target frame. New fields in the target data are named by using the names of the data frames and fields (<data>_<field>). In addition, the operation creates a field called "time" to the target data frame to which the matched points are stored.
